Magic ETL Join visual feedback (summary of join results)

one thing that i miss deeply from one of the other BI Platforms is getting some idea of what is occurring with a join.
right now, to check a join, i have to create several branches of validation to count the nulls, count the rows, check for intersections/mismatch sets, etc. all i really want is when i run preview, it would also then do some basic checks against the datasets to tell me how many rows from each table are being evaluated with the amount of mismatches from either side (join-type dependent obviously) with the total amount being returned.
